New generation of SA politicians is emerging

A new generation of South African leaders are rising.

The Daily Maverick has published a list of rising political stars to watch. 702's Bongani Bingwa spoke to one of the co-authors, Sune Payne.
The list of 15 individuals cuts across the political spectrum.
First up in the discussion were the lesser-known names who are beginning to find fame, for example, the ad hoc committee in parliament investigating criminality in law enforcement.
Ashley Sauls (42), the Patriotic Alliance leader in Parliament and former Beaufort West mayor, is one of them.
"If you've caught any bits of the ad hoc committee, you'll see Ashley. Even when it's not so popular, he asks questions to interrogate who is in front of them," said Payne.
An MP for the MK Party, Sibonelo Nomvalo, is also on the ad hoc committee. "He certainly has been asking some tough questions, too," said Bingwa.
Payne agreed. "He's a lawyer, so naturally you'd expect him to be a tough persona. He has shown his grit."
Moving to the ANC members on the list, International Relations and Cooperation Minister Ronald Lamola is one of those who stand out. The 42-year-old was previously Minister of Justice and Correctional Services.
"He has been in charge of our international diplomacy. When we saw him at the G20, he was in the zone promoting South Africa. And remember last year, South Africa faced unprecedented attacks, including from President Trump and even internally, but he stood his ground," said Payne.
The DA has several names on the Daily Maverick's list. Payne said it shows the investment they have made in their younger leaders.
"If you listen to Dean Macpherson (Minister of Public Works and Infrastructure), about two weeks ago, he was saying that DA leader John Steenhuisen has actually mentored a lot of young people, including himself, Siviwe Gwarube and Geordin Hill-Lewis.
